Polk County Deputy Nabs Ormond Beach Man Driving 102 From Tampa With Children In Car

Polk County Sheriff’s Office Arrests Speeding Driver, Uncovers Felon Status and Child Neglect

POLK COUNTY, Fla. – A routine traffic stop for excessive speeding on Interstate 4 yesterday afternoon led to the arrest of a 26-year-old man facing multiple charges, including child neglect, after a Polk County Sheriff’s Office deputy discovered he was a registered gang member on federal probation with no valid driver’s license.

At approximately 1:00 PM on Tuesday, July 15th, Polk County Sheriff Deputy Janiak observed a gray 2024 Toyota SUV traveling eastbound on I-4 at a speed significantly exceeding the posted 70 mph limit. A radar confirmed the vehicle’s speed at 102 mph.

A traffic stop was initiated, and the driver was identified as Christian Jovanni Agosto, 26. Agosto informed Deputy Janiak that he was en route from Tampa to his residence in Ormond Beach…
